First-Year Admission Calendar (for enrollment in Fall 2024) November 1, 2023 (Early Decision) Review of Early Decision applications begins. Early-to-mid December, 2023 (Early Decision) Decision notices to Early Decision applicants sent electronically on or around this date. January 3, 2024 (Regular Decision)
6 mar 2024 · View Full Report Card. Amherst is an elite private college located in Amherst Center, Massachusetts in the Springfield, MA Area. It is a small institution with an enrollment of 1,971 undergraduate students. Admissions is extremely competitive as the Amherst acceptance rate is only 9%. Popular majors include Mathematics, Economics, and Research ...
Amherst College, private, independent liberal-arts college for men and women in Amherst, Massachusetts, U.S., established in 1821 and chartered in 1825. The lexicographer Noah Webster was one of the founders of the college, which was originally intended to train indigent men for the ministry.

In addition to the requirements described above, students must attain a grade of B or better in Economics 111 or a grade of B- or better in an Amherst College economics elective (numbered 200-290) before being allowed to register for a core course (numbered 300-361) or to add the economics major.
